Posting the details or error messages you're receiving would help.
Also, I believe there's a newsgroup for SUS. www.susserver.com might
be helpful as well, there's a forum there I believe. Searching
www.google.com and www.google.com/advanced_group_search for your error
messages might help as well.
Did you [or SUS] by any chance install one of the last patches for
Exchange / OWA on the SUS server? That makes changes to your ASP
files, read the documentation for details.
If it's a problem with ACLs, the error message you're getting should
plainly tell you that. Also, enabling file auditing would help you
determine what ACL is missing from what file and which user:
http://securityadmin.info/faq.asp#auditing
Filemon free from www.sysinternals.com might help here as well, but I
recommend auditing.
